S 900 United States Senate · 118th Congress

Conservation and Innovative Climate Partnership Act of 2023

This bill establishes a new competitive grant program to help farmers and ranchers adopt climate-smart conservation practices. It provides $13 million annually for grants to eligible land-grant universities (1862, 1890, and 1994 institutions) to fund outreach, workshops, and technical assistance. Grants require a 25% increase in farmer engagement and partnerships with entities like the Natural Resources Conservation Service, focusing on practices that improve soil health, reduce emissions, and sequester carbon. Each grant is capped at $400,000 for up to 4 years, with no more than 30% of funds used for administrative costs. The program directly supports agricultural producers seeking to voluntarily implement climate-friendly farming methods.
